Heres the entire story :

2007 Formula one world champion, Kimi Raikkonen, has just signed a new two year deal with Citroen Junior Team which will keep him in the WRC until at least the end of 2012.

Rumours had started to appear once again after the fiasco and the Turkish GP, however with Webber and Vettel making up, it looks as if Red Bull have offered the Aussie a new one year deal with the Austrian team.

Kimi Raikkonen was a possibility to replace Mark, however that has now ended and Kimi will stay in the WRC for another two years.Kimi is happy in the WRC and he believes next years cars would "suit (his) driving style".

A fifth place in only his fifth rally was an excellent result and Kimi could become a future WRC world champion.

The announcement is likely to be made in July. Webber's contract with Red Bull could be announced sometime in the next three weeks.

BILD IS TAKING KIMI TO RED BULL

Turun Sanomat 28.3 2010 18:33:23

Bild Zeitung claimed they got hints that Räikkönen would be offered a 3-year deal in Red Bull and his salary would be about the same as Vettel's.

Bild asked Vettel what kind of relationship he has with Räikkönen.

– We are really good friends. Kimi is a little better in badminton and he can stay in sauna longer than me. Finns are unbeatable in that, Vettel said.

Has Räikkönen's deal been made already?

I don't know about the team's plans. But in the end it's Kimi's decision. Only he knows what he wants to do, Vettel said.

Melbourne/Heikki Kulta
